    Key Job Responsibilities and Duties:

    • Lead and manage a team of engineers in a fast-paced and complex environment.

    • Own the architecture across the team and drive architectural alignment.

    • Define, shape and deliver the technical roadmap.

    • Inspire and motivate a global and cross-functional team.

    • Lead by example by taking ownership, being proactive and collaborating.

    • Ensure operational excellence and own technical incident management.

    Qualifications & Skills:

    • 2+ years leading and managing a team of 3-6 software developers, ensuring their professional development and effectiveness.

    • At least 5 years of hands-on experience in software development.

    • Experience with Java, Scala or Kotlin as a server side programming language.

    • Demonstrated experience with technologies such as Kubernetes, Docker, MySQL and Redis.

    • Relevant experience working on high-scale distributed systems that impact a large customer base.

    • BSc or MSc or equivalent experience in Computer Science, Engineering or a related field, or equal industry experience.

    • Experience in leading cross functional teams and development of AI/ML products. Advantage..
